c# - 有什么方法可以创建查询,包括投影中的函数和 sqlkata 中的外部应用?
问题描述
我需要 sqlkata 中的一些高级 SQL 功能,例如在投影中外部应用 IIF 表达式。有没有办法在 sqlkata 中创建这样的查询?
解决方案
实现这一点的唯一方法是使用该SelectRaw
方法。
query.SelectRaw("IIF(a > b, 'larger', 'smaller') as col").Select("Id");
推荐阅读
- javascript - TypeError:t.map 不是函数 react-dom.production.min.js:216
- php - 特定类别的 Wocomerce 隐藏价格
- soap - 如何编写 xsd 模式以生成重用相同输出类型的 wsdl 操作?
- javascript - 使用 JavaSCript 将活动类动态添加到动态构建的导航菜单行项
- python - 尽管在返回行中指定了 print(),但定义的函数仍然返回 None
- python - 用自写函数绘制椭圆
- r - 带有“<-”的for循环在R中创建变量
- amazon-cognito - SAML 响应处理中的错误:在 SAML 响应中找不到 SAML 断言
- python - 将图像交错更改为 BIL
- javascript - 调整大小